Billy Gardner Billy Gardner
Full name: William Frederick Gardner
Born: July 19, 1927, Waterford, Connecticut
First Game: April 22, 1954; Final Game: September 11, 1963
Managed First Game: May 22, 1981; Managed Final Game: August 26, 1987
Bat: Right Throw: Right Height: 6' 0" Weight: 170

TransactionsTransactions
Signed as an amateur free agent by New York Giants (1945).

Sold by New York Giants to Baltimore Orioles for $20000 (April 21, 1956).

Traded by Baltimore Orioles to Washington Senators in exchange for Clint Courtney
and Ron Samford (April 3, 1960).

Traded by Minnesota Twins to New York Yankees in exchange for Danny McDevitt (June
14, 1961).

Traded by New York Yankees to Boston Red Sox in exchange for Tom Umphlett and cash
(June 12, 1962).

Released by Boston Red Sox (October 2, 1963).
